App privacy posture

Universal Fit is designed as an offline-first workout app. The app keeps workout plans and logs on your device for core tracking features and does not include ads, analytics, or crash-reporting telemetry.

Debloat does not collect, sell, share, or transmit your workout data to Debloat servers.

Data stored locally on your device

When you use the app, Universal Fit may store imported workout-plan JSON, active and completed training sessions, set logs, cardio logs, exercise notes, exercise feedback, body weight values you enter, app settings, available plate sizes, language preference, current plan and session state, and related workout history.

This data is stored locally using app storage such as SQLite, MMKV, and the device file system. It is used to render plans, track workouts, calculate history, remember preferences, and keep the app working offline.

Files, clipboard, sharing, notifications, and haptics

If you choose to import a file, paste from the clipboard, copy a prompt or validation report, or open a shared JSON file on Android, the app accesses that content only to perform the action you requested.

The app may use local notifications and haptics for rest timers if you enable or use those features. These are local device features and are not remote push notifications from a Debloat server.

Website privacy

The Universal Fit website is a static site hosted on GitHub Pages. Debloat does not run a custom backend for the site, does not set tracking cookies, and does not currently use site analytics.

The site stores your selected website language in browser localStorage so language switching can work across pages. GitHub Pages and your browser or network provider may process standard request information, such as IP address and user agent, under their own policies.

Retention and deletion

Workout data remains on your device until you delete it, delete the app data, or uninstall the app. Deleting a plan in the app is intended to remove that plan and related sessions from local app storage.

Full export and full reset controls are planned or in progress. Until those controls are complete, use the app features that are available for individual deletion and your operating system controls for app data removal.
